So marv, you're elbow problem is because you broke it before? Just wondering because that is the only reference I've seen to what could be wrong so I don't know if I missed any recent aggravating event.

Anyway, I don't know if this will help but for any nagging joint problems I've found a heat rub before the workout to be very useful. I've used it extensively for both elbows and shoudlers. Trust me, you go to a hardcore lifter's club and besides a lot of chalk in the air you will also smell a lot of menthol

Thursday 6th december
PR day

Squat 152.5kg 1x3
Bench 120kg 1x2
Deadlift 190kg Made it Half way
Chins 20kg 3x5
hanging leg raises
Calve raise 410lbs

I made 1 more rep on squats. Bench has stalled. I didnt make the deadlift. Press has stalled. Rows would need to drop down a couple of kgs and be done for more reps to keep proper technique. It is possible I could make another rep on volume squat day. I could try and add 2.5kg to volume bench and go for a 3x2. However this run seems to be at an end. I have been on this program for about 19 or 20 weeks. Any advice Eric, or anyone else.

Replace Max Effort work with Speed work on PR days??????

Might help push along the volume days which should lead to new Rms when you go back to ME stuff.

I think Rip advises this In PP.
